Battery life/range: Immediately after price, this will be the next deciding issue for many. It is a bit challenging to provide an accurate estimate of battery life and range, because it's dependent on several different aspects, including the rider's weight, the temperature, as well as terrain �?in case you are riding on flat surfaces, you'll go much farther than if you are riding up and down hills.

Any person who uses a powered transporter with a public road or other prohibited space in breach with the law is committing a felony offence and can be prosecuted.

It truly is an offence to work with powered transporters around the pavement. By section 72, Highway Act 1835 it is actually an offence to ride on, or to steer or draw a carriage with a pavement. This rule applies almost all vehicles, with Specific legal exceptions for mobility scooters and wheelchairs.
